血清睾酮水平与COVID-19的严重程度相关联。

Serum Testosterone Is Associated With the Severity of COVID-19.

摘要:

2019年冠状病毒病(COVID-19)在男性中比女性更容易严重。其与性激素作为男性患者恶化因素的关联已引起关注。本研究旨在调查血清睾酮是否与COVID-19的恶化有关。测量和检验了2020年2月1日至2021年3月31日期间入院札幌医科大学医院的116名男性COVID-19患者和剩余血清的血清睾酮浓度。从这些COVID-19患者收集的血液样本进行分析。轻度、中度和重度组中,严重COVID-19在入院时的血清睾酮水平分别为2.19±1.35、1.29±0.88和0.75±0.58 ng/ml。入院时有严重COVID-19的患者睾酮水平较低(p<0.001)。在1.31 ng/ml的截断水平下,比较严重和非严重病例的曲线下面积为0.825。此外,血清睾酮水平与C-反应蛋白和血清淀粉酸水平呈负相关,与钙、锌、C3和C4呈正相关。在COVID-19男性患者中,低血清睾酮水平与疾病的严重程度相关,伴随强烈的炎症反应和补体消耗比例。版权所有 © 2023,国际抗癌研究所(George J. Coronavirus disease 2019 (COVID-19) is more likely to be severe in men than in women. Its association with sex hormones as an aggravating factor for male patients has been attracting attention. This study aimed to investigate whether serum testosterone is associated with the aggravation of COVID-19.Serum testosterone concentrations in 116 male patients with COVID-19 and residual serum were measured and examined upon their admission to Sapporo Medical University Hospital between February 1, 2020 and March 31, 2021.Blood samples collected from these patients with COVID-19 were analyzed. The serum testosterone levels were 2.19±1.35, 1.29±0.88, and 0.75±0.58 ng/ml in mild, moderate, and severe groups, respectively. Patients with severe COVID-19 on admission had lower testosterone levels (p<0.001). At a cutoff level of 1.31 ng/ml, the area under the curve for the comparison of severe with non-severe cases was 0.825. Furthermore, serum testosterone levels negatively correlated with C-reactive protein and serum amyloid A levels but positively correlated with calcium, zinc, C3, and C4.In male patients with COVID-19, low serum testosterone levels correlated with disease severity, accompanied by a strong inflammatory reaction and proportion of complement consumption.Copyright © 2023, International Institute of Anticancer Research (Dr. George J.
